We are looking for IT Business Systems Analyst for Technology, Canada Life & Great-West Life within the Workplace Solutions – Claims area.
What will you be doing?
- Join us in a fun, friendly, team-oriented environment, working closely with a coach/mentor
- Work on a variety of application systems that are used by the Health & Dental Claims group within Canada Life; performs analysis to determine impacts to systems
- Validates requirements and proposed solutions to stakeholder’s satisfaction and translates those processes, needs and requirements into related artifacts and documentation
- Troubleshoots simple to moderate problems to determine root-cause, requiring analysis and exploration of options, recommending solutions or preparing discussion for escalation
- Partners with developers and other team members to resolve defects, considering data and privacy requirements
- Learn how we use collaboration tools - work with our team to design and develop collaboration solutions to be used by IS team.
- Contribute learning from education experience to practical process improvement opportunities.
What will you be using?
You will be digging into a legacy system developed using a hierarchical and procedural programming language, so experience in any of these areas is a plus:
- Mainframe COBOL
- Java, C, C#/.Net, VB
- Oracle, MS SQL, DB2

Canada Life serves the financial security needs of more than 13 million people across Canada, with additional operations in Europe and the United States. As members of the Power Financial Corporation group of companies, we’re one of Canada’s leading insurers with interests in life insurance, health insurance, investment and retirement savings. We offer a broad portfolio of financial and benefit plan solutions for individuals, families, businesses and organizations.
